Frequently Asked Questions
Should I buy a house in Broomehill-Tambellup?
Broomehill-Tambellup has an overall Medium climate risk rating. The best approach is to obtain an address-level climate risk report for any property you are considering, get pre-purchase insurance quotes, review council hazard maps, and factor climate projections into your long-term ownership plan.
What due diligence is needed before buying in Broomehill-Tambellup?
Due diligence for Broomehill-Tambellup property purchases should include: climate risk report for the specific address, flood and bushfire overlay review from your local council, pre-purchase insurance quotes, understanding disclosure obligations under Western Australia law, and considering long-term climate projections to 2050.
How will climate change affect property values in Broomehill-Tambellup?
Climate change may affect Broomehill-Tambellup property values through insurance affordability, buyer risk perception, lender conditions in high-risk areas, and physical damage from extreme weather. Properties with lower hazard exposure may command premiums over higher-risk properties in the same suburb.
